The HPG400 gauges have been designed for vacuum measurement of non-flam-
mable gases and gas mixtures in a pressure range of 2×10

-6

… 1 mbar. The con-

trol range of the gauge allows trend display from <1 mbar to 1000 mbar.

The gauges can be operated in connection with the INFICON Vacuum Gauge
Controller VGC4XX or with other control devices.

The HPG400 functions with a HP (high pressure) hot cathode ionization manome-
ter, which is controlled by the built-in Pirani manometer (control range). The hot
cathode is switched on only below the switching threshold of

≈1 mbar (to prevent

filament burn-out). For pressures above this threshold, the Pirani signal is output.

Over the whole measuring range, the measuring signal is output as logarithm of the
pressure.
